State Legislative Bill Actions
April 24, 2020

State tobacco-related legislative bills that have been acted on by a state legislative committee or state legislature are listed below alphabetically by state:

Kentucky: CORRECTION: House Bill 32, which was amended to repeal the vapor tax sections in previously adopted HB 351 and amended to include the same taxes on vapor products ($1.50 per cartridge of closed vapor cartridges and 15% of the distributor price for open vaping systems), was posted for passage on concurrence but failed when the legislature adjourned on April 15, 2020. Therefore, House Bill 351, which was passed by the House and Senate and included the vapor taxes, was delivered to the Secretary of State on April 15, 2020.

Minnesota: House File 331, which increases the tobacco sales age to 21 years of age and adds charter schools to the prohibition of tobacco in schools, will be heard in the Ways and Means Committee on April 27, 2020.
